Field Goals

Field goals can let your team win the game. It’s an essential tactic for fourth down situations. Field goal kicking is useful when your team has the ball close enough to the goal post to allow your kicker to attempt a field goal kick between the uprights. Field goals are worth three points.

Try scoring a touchdown for your team. The goal of the offense is to get the ball into the end zone each time they have possession. To get a touchdown, a single player must bring the ball over the opposition goal line, or catch a pass thrown to them as they are inside the end zone. When the ball passes the goal line with the player holding it, a touchdown is scored. Your team receives six points for scoring a touchdown.

Working on developing passing routes that succeed. Do not expect receivers to run straight up on the field. Slants and crossing routes give receivers the opportunity to evade opponents and get into the open. If a receiver dashes forward and then runs across the field, it is known as a crossing route. When a player runs diagonally, it is called a slant route. Any route can get the ball where it needs to go.

There is an art to catching a football as rain pelts down. Avoid slipping by pointing your feet towards the ball. You will also feel more in control when the ball lands in your hands. Keep your hips and chest over your legs. Grab the ball with both hands, and keep going!

As the quarterback, it is your responsibility to thoroughly scan the defensive line from left and right and vice versa. Most quarterbacks only scan left to right. If you alter scan patterns, you can keep defense guessing and stop them from blindsiding you.
